Avoiding Routine Cleaning



Although you could think avoiding routine brushing conserves time, it can cause a host of brushing issues down the line.

Routine cleaning eliminates loose hair, dust, and particles, avoiding floor coverings and tangles from developing. If you overlook this vital action, your dog's layer can end up being matted, making it uncomfortable and difficult to groom later. This can additionally catch wetness versus the skin, potentially causing skin irritations or infections.

And also, cleaning is an outstanding chance to check for any kind of unusual lumps or skin issues. Goal to comb your dog at the very least when a week, or regularly if they have actually a longer layer.

This simple habit not just maintains their coat healthy and balanced, however it also reinforces your bond with your furry buddy.

Overlooking to Bathe Correctly



After maintaining your dog's coat free of floor coverings and tangles with routine brushing, it's time to focus on bathing. Overlooking proper showering methods can bring about skin problems and a dirty coat.

Always make use of a dog-specific hair shampoo to avoid irritation; human products can be as well severe. Make sure to wet your dog completely, starting from the neck down, and function the hair shampoo into the layer, reaching the skin.



Wash extensively to eliminate all soap residue, as leftover hair shampoo can cause itching. Do not neglect to dry your pet dog well after the bath; damp hair can cause odors and skin issues.

Regular, correct showering maintains your pet dog's coat healthy, glossy, and scenting fresh.

Overlooking Ear and Eye Care



While you may concentrate on your canine's layer, don't overlook ear and eye care, as these locations can quickly be overlooked.

On a regular basis inspect your pet dog's ears for dust, wax accumulation, or indicators of infection. Make use of a wet cotton ball or a vet-recommended cleaner to delicately clean the outer ear. Be cautious not to put anything deep right into the ear canal.

For eye care, examine your pet dog's eyes for inflammation, discharge, or cloudiness. Wipe away any tear discolorations with a soft towel.

If you notice consistent concerns, consult your veterinarian, as they could show underlying wellness issues. Focusing on ear and eye care guarantees your pet dog remains comfortable and healthy and balanced, adding to a flawless grooming routine.

Indicators of Overgrown Nails



If you notice your dog limping or waiting to walk on tough surface areas, it could be an indicator of thick nails. Lengthy nails can create pain, bring about changes in your pet's gait.

You may additionally observe your puppy dragging their paws or avoiding certain tasks they as soon as appreciated. Pay attention for clicking audios when they stroll-- this indicates nails are also long.

In addition, look for nails that crinkle or split; these can cause uncomfortable injuries. If your canine regularly licks their paws or programs indications of irritation, maybe linked to their nails.

Routine trimming is essential to avoid these problems, ensuring your canine stays comfy and healthy. Don't disregard the indicators; act to maintain those nails!

Failing to Check for Skin Issues



While grooming your dog, it's easy to overlook skin concerns that may be lurking underneath their hair. Regularly examining your dog's skin is important for their wellness.

Seek redness, bumps, or unusual patches-- these can suggest allergic reactions, infections, or bloodsuckers. Pay attention to delicate areas like the stomach, underarms, and behind the ears, where skin problems frequently hide.

If you notice any type of abnormalities, consult your vet for guidance before proceeding with pet grooming. Falling short to deal with these issues can lead to pain for your pet dog and a less than perfect surface.

Utilizing Human Products on Pets



Noticing skin problems throughout grooming can lead you to consider what products to make use of for your pet dog's care.

It may be tempting to order your favored human shampoo or lotion, but that's an error. Human items frequently consist of active ingredients that can aggravate your pet's skin or cause allergies. Canines have various skin pH degrees, so what works for you might damage them.

Rather, stick to products particularly formulated for dogs. These are developed to resolve their unique demands, ensuring a healthy and balanced layer and skin. Always read labels, and consult your veterinarian if you're unclear.

Selecting the best items not just aids your pet really feel comfy however additionally adds to a flawless grooming finish.
